天天看點

钣金行業MES系統資料模型的設計與實作

作者:慧都智能制造

企業的钣金工廠中的房間作為基本生産單元,主要負責壁闆、框段等钣金類零件的生産,在早期,钣金工廠中的房間完成了MES系統一期的建設及實施應用,打通了工廠中的房間生産的資訊化管理鍊路,但随着公司钣金型号任務數量逐漸增加,品質管控要求越來越嚴格,成本控制要求越來越精細,原有的MES系統資料模型不能适應工廠中的房間日益細化的業務管理需求。

通路慧都網了解钣金行業MES方案詳情>>

一、需求分析

前期钣金工廠中的房間完成了MES系統一期建設及實施應用。一期MES系統以型号計劃、月度計劃、工廠中的房間作業計劃和班組派工單等生産計劃為主線,重點解決了業務流程中的關鍵節點和關鍵過程。

但是,随着系統逐漸深入應用和生産業務逐漸完善,當公司生産管理或者品質管控發生變化的時候,工廠中的房間管理方式可以快速進行調整,以滿足公司新增管理規定的要求, 但是原有的MES系統資料模型則需要對業務邏輯、流程資料及資料結構進行多處修改,甚至需要對資料模型進行“推倒重建”,才能滿足業務變更需求,是以工廠中的房間原有的資料模型不能很好适應工廠中的房間日益細化的業務需求。

MES系統一期的資料模型存在的問題如下:

1、無法适應工廠中的房間業務變更和品質管控細化

MES系統一期的資料模型的建設思路是以 “流程驅動”為核心,重點實作關鍵業務的電子化。但是,當工廠中的房間業務流程進行優化或者品質管控細化,工廠中的房間原有的強耦合資料模型不能很好地融入現有業務之中,不僅起不到“添磚加瓦”的作用,反而成為了業務過程中的羁絆。

2、無法覆寫工廠中的房間生産中的異常情況

MES系統一期的資料模型重點打通了工廠中的房間生産任務逐級細化和任務分解的資訊化管理鍊路,但是工廠中的房間在生産任務執行過程中,可能會遇到各種各樣的異常情況,例如技術更改、工裝返修、裝置故障、原材料實物有劃傷等等情況。 這些生産異常情況在工廠中的房間原資料模型是未涉及的,随着工廠中的房間生産管理要求逐漸細化,原資料模型無法滿足工廠中的房間對所有的業務過程管控需求。

3、無法适應職能處室業務需求變更

在建立钣金工廠中的房間資料模型過程中,不僅僅需要考慮工廠中的房間業務邏輯需求,還需要考慮企業各個處室對于工廠中的房間各項業務資料的需求變化,比如生産處對于工廠中的房間執行情況考核資料、财務處需要的原材料成本統計、人力處需要的工時統計以及裝置處需要的裝置運作資料等,需要滿足處室業務變更所帶來的變化。

钣金行業MES系統資料模型的設計與實作

慧都MES系統界面效果圖

二、MES系統資料模型設計思路

為了滿足工廠中的房間業務變更和品質管控細化的需求,我們從産品制造過程和工廠中的房間生産模式上對原有的工廠中的房間資料模型進行了優化和再造,将單一的強耦合的資料模型分解為強内聚低耦合的制造過程模型和業務領域模型,實作了工廠中的房間業務變更的快速響應、覆寫工廠中的房間所有業務、打通工廠中的房間與職能處室壁壘。

制造過程模型是産品生産制造過程的抽象, 将工廠中的房間每一項生産任務抽象為一個任務執行管道, 管道中包括各種定制的正常節點和異常節點。通過記錄生産任務執行過程中所發生的節點,還原整個生産任務的執行過程,實作生産任務全過程的流程記錄和資料記錄。當工廠中的房間制造流程發生變更時候,僅僅需要對任務管道模闆和節點進行修改,而不會影響到工廠中的房間的資料結構,實作了工廠中的房間業務變更的系統快速響應。

業務領域模型是對工廠中的房間業務的抽象,将工廠中的房間核心域劃分為16個業務領域進行模組化,主要包括工藝管理、品質管理、工裝管理、裝置管理、工具管理、量具管理、原材料管理、成本管理、任務執行等,基本涵蓋工廠中的房間目前所有的業務。 通過業務領域模型,将原本依據業務流程模組化方式,優化為依據工廠中的房間核心領域模組化方式,從根本上将系統資料結構與工廠中的房間管理進行了融合。

業務領域模型以提供領域服務方式,被工廠中的房間制造流程模型中的制造節點調用,将制造流程和業務領域進行解耦,隻有當工廠中的房間業務領域發生變化的時候,例如制造模式改變,才會對工廠中的房間業務領域模型進行修正。

業務領域模型通過消息總線的方式,與企業各職能處室的領域進行系統內建,将企業的生産管理模式由“處室提要求、工廠中的房間被動執行回報”轉變為“處室訂閱工廠中的房間業務領域的消息,自動接收生産業務資料”新的生産管理模式。

三、MES系統資料模型實作

1、制造過程模型的實作

針對公司産品生産過程的不确定性、制造管理的複雜性,設計開發了以“任務管道”運作為核心的制造過程模型,其核心思想是根據不同生産任務需求建構不同的任務管道,并為其綁定不同的制造節點。 在制造執行鍊路執行過程中,可以對制造節點進行調整和觸發異常情況,實作對産品制造過程的全生命周期管理。

正常節點是構成工廠中的房間任務管道執行的最基本單元,也是任務執行過程具體表現。 按照正常節點的執行方式,分為自動節點和人工節點,對于自動節點,系統會自動完成該節點工作,并将結果回報給執行角色;對于人工節點,需要執行人員在系統中進行處理和填報。自動執行節點的多少也是衡量一個工廠中的房間自動化程度的重要名額。

工廠中的房間在生産任務執行過程中,會發生各種各樣的異常情況,而這些異常情況處理往往是排程員和工廠中的房間主任所關注的重點, 這些異常情況基本都是公司各職能處室按照公司品質管理體系進行處理的。當管理顆粒度細化或者管理方式調整,異常情況處理流程需要進行更新和調整。是以,需要在任務管道中增加異常節點,以實作對異常處理過程的記錄。

2、業務領域模型的實作

業務領域模型是對工廠中的房間業務的抽象,主要包括領域服務、領域模型和資料結構。 通過業務領域模型,将原本依據業務流程建構資料庫結構的方式,優化為依據工廠中的房間核心領域模組化方式,從根本上将系統資料結構與工廠中的房間管理進行了融合。業務領域模型是對工廠中的房間業務管理的資訊映射,隻有當工廠中的房間管理模式(例如制造模式、工裝單件管理、工具多件管理)改變的時候,才會進行調整。

領域服務在業務領域模型中起着承上啟下作用,它是由領域模型所提供,被工廠中的房間制造過程模型中的正常節點調用,通過進行資料存儲,完成業務資料的持久化過程。 在系統模組化過程中,由于工廠中的房間管理基本都是按照體系要求進行的,領域服務與企業品質管理系統要求是對應關系,是以領域服務搭建就是将管理體系檔案的系統化過程。

四、應用效果

钣金工廠中的房間MES系統資料模型通過實際應用,取得了以下效果:

1、通過建立工廠中的房間資料模型,有效提升MES系統适應生産業務變化的能力。 钣金工廠中的房間資料模型建立,将業務變化和模式變化進行區分, 把單一的強耦合的資料模型分解為制造流程模型和業務領域模型,有效提升了系統适應各種業務變化的能力。

2、實作了産品生産制造的全過程追溯,有效提升産品品質控制。“生産任務管道”運作過程包含了從任務分解、任務績效評價和産品傳遞整個産品制造生命周期, 涉及了産品制造過程的計劃、物料、生産準備、品質、進度、異常處理等所有業務流程。 通過還原“生産任務管道”,實作從時間、事件、裝置和人員多元度進行産品制造過程的記錄和追溯。

3、逐漸形成了工廠中的房間管理體系的建設路徑。 在钣金工廠中的房間MES系統建設過程中,将工廠中的房間正常節點和異常節點按照工藝、生産、品質、裝置等方面進行分類彙總,形成工廠中的房間管理體系建設圖。 通過工廠中的房間管理體系建設圖,為後續工廠中的房間資訊化建設提供了建設依據以及建設路徑,将傳統的“推倒重來”的系統建設方式轉變為“繼往開來”的建設模式,為後續公司資訊化建設指明了方向。

五、結束語

本文以“制造資料”為驅動,從産品制造過程和工廠中的房間生産模式上對原有的工廠中的房間資料模型進行了優化和再造,建立MES系統的資料模型, 有效提升MES系統适應公司業務變化的能力,實作了産品制造生命周期追溯和品質管控。

慧都科技深耕制造企業十多年,在钣金行業APS、MES系統實施方面擁有豐富的經驗,如您的企業也屬于钣金行業,歡迎私信留言,我們将免費為您提供解決方案并發送相關案例資料!

繼續閱讀